- MPESB EXCISE POLICE CONSTABLE Syllabus 2025In SYLLABUS·February 16, 2025MPESB EXCISE POLICE CONSTABLE Syllabus 2025 The Madhya Pradesh Employees Selection Board (MPESB) has released the syllabus and exam pattern for the Excise Constable Recruitment 2025. The selection process comprises a Written Examination, Physical Standard Test (PST), and Physical Efficiency Test (PET). Written Examination: • Mode: Online Computer-Based Test (CBT) • Duration: 2 hours • Total Questions: 100 • Total Marks: 100 • Negative Marking: 1/3 mark deducted for each incorrect answer Exam Pattern: Subject Questions Marks General Knowledge & Logical Reasoning 40 40 Intellectual Ability & Mental Aptitude 30 30 Science & Simple Arithmetic 30 30 Total 100 100 Syllabus Details: 1. General Knowledge & Logical Reasoning: • Topics: • National & International Current Affairs • Indian History & World History • Geography • Polity • Economics • Sports • Famous Places in India • Special focus on Madhya Pradesh • Logical Reasoning topics like Analogy, Coding-Decoding, Blood Relations, Syllogism, etc. 2. Intellectual Ability & Mental Aptitude: • Topics: • Averages • Percentage • Profit & Loss • Ratio & Proportion • Time & Work • Time & Distance • Basic Algebra • Geometry (Triangles, Circles, Quadrilaterals) • Mensuration (Right Circular Cone, Cylinder, Sphere) 3. Science & Simple Arithmetic: • Topics: • Physics: Motion, Gravitation, Light, Electricity • Chemistry: Matter and its States, Atomic Structure, Chemical Reactions, Acids, Bases & Salts • Biology: Human Body Structure, Diseases • Simple Arithmetic: Basic mathematical operations, Simplifications, Square Roots Physical Standard Test (PST): • Male Candidates: • Height: 167.5 cm • Chest: 81 cm (unexpanded) to 86 cm (expanded) • Female Candidates: • Height: 152.4 cm • Chest: Not applicable Candidates are advised to refer to the official MPESB notification for detailed information and updates. - NHPC/THDC Junior Engineer Syllabus 2023In SYLLABUS·June 10, 2023Medium of Examination - English & Hindi Examination Duration -3 Hrs. (180 minutes) Total Marks - 200 Marks Subjects - For Jr. Engineer (Civil/ Electrical/ Mechanical/ E&C), Supervisor (IT), Supervisor (Survey), Sr. Accountant & Draftsman (Civil) & Draftsman (Electrical/Mechanical) - (200 Questions): Part-I consists of 140 MCQ of the concerned discipline (Civil/Electrical/Mechanical Engineering). Part-II consists of 30 MCQ on General Awareness and Part-III of 30 MCQ on Reasoning For Hindi Translator Post (110 Questions): Part-I consists of 40 MCQ and 10 Descriptive Type questions of the concerned discipline. Part-III of 30 MCQ on Reasoning Marking For every correct answer of MCQ, one mark shall be awarded. For every wrong answer attempted by the candidates, negative marking of marks (i.e. 0.25 marks) will be deducted. All the descriptive type of questions will have 10 marks each without any negative marking. No marks will be awarded/deducted for un-attempted questions. - SBI Syllabus 2023 | SBI Specialist Cadre Officer SCO Syllabus 2023In SYLLABUS·April 29, 2023SBI Syllabus 2023 | SBI Specialist Cadre Officer SCO Syllabus 2023 The selection of Regular positions of JMGS-I/ MMGS-II will be on the basis of Online Written Test and Interview. Online written Test: The online written test will be conducted tentatively in June 2023. The call letter of test will be uploaded on Bank’s website and also advised to the candidates through SMS and e-mails. Candidates will be required to download the call letters.
